Minutes — Management Meeting

Prepared for the incoming director. Topic: possible acquisition of Greyfen Analytics. Due diligence 70% complete. Valuation gap remains; Greyfen seeks a premium. Integration risks flagged by Ops. Decision deferred to next month. Talla Nyberg leads negotiations. Our walk-away position is stated below.

board note of fawig-kagup: Only 48 of the 435 pilot accounts renewed Rusion, so a churn review is set for September 12. Fenwynox Logistics is in early talks to buy Sorielek Systems for about $117.8 million.

## Runbook — Invoisa PDF Renderer Failures

When a customer reports a blank or truncated invoice PDF, first confirm the render job completed in the Invoisa queue dashboard. If the job shows success but output is malformed, the font-embedding cache is the usual culprit; escalate to the rendering team rather than retrying more than twice, since retries regenerate invoice numbers in draft state. Include the customer's invoice date range in the escalation, along with the render-build token shown below.

pipeline stamp: htk31_f769b577b3028a4e9958e5bb8d1259a

**Action item:** Following the Pinemark reset-flow outage, reset links now expire sooner and reuse is blocked. Support should expect more "link expired" contacts; resend rather than troubleshoot. Lockout after repeated failed attempts clears automatically, so no manual unlocks. The new expiry and lockout constants are listed below for reference.

tuning constants:
QUOTAS = {
    "druwyn": 5,
    "holix": 5,
    "zorath": 5,
    "holwyn": 10,
}

**Handover: tax-rate lookup cache (Orvale billing service)**

For the security review: the cache stores jurisdiction-to-rate mappings with a six-hour TTL and is invalidated on upstream rate-table changes. Entries are keyed by a hashed region code; no customer data is cached. Stale-read risk is bounded by the TTL, and a manual flush endpoint exists behind the admin role. Audit logging covers flushes and misses. Ongoing responsibility for this component transfers to the person named below.

approver of yawig-yajef = Briius Jorix